Supplies Needed for Candy Corn Craft

  • Paper plate – A 10-inch paper plate gives you a great size for the candy corn, but you could use any size.
  • Scissors  – Just a standard craft scissors for this project. You may consider using kid’s safe scissors if doing this project with little ones.
  • Construction paper – A mix of standard yellow and orange construction paper, but you could also use cardstock.
  • Glue stick – A glue stick works great for this craft, but you could use any non-toxic craft glue.
  • Glitter card stock – A glitter card stock was used for the eyes for this project, but you could use any construction paper or cardstock.
  • Marker – Any black marker will work for this craft.
  • Wooden craft stick – A standard wooden craft stick works perfect, but you could also use recycled popsicle sticks.

How to Make Candy Corn Craft

In only takes 10 minutes to make this quick and easy fall craft. Perfect for young children with short attention spans.

If you are doing this with toddlers, cut the construction paper before you start so they just need to glue and decorate the candy corn with faces!

The first step is to cut the edge around the entire circumference of the paper plate to make it flat. Then cut the plate into 6 equal triangles.

After you have your triangles cut out for the candy corn cut a piece of yellow and orange construction paper into 1 ½ inch strips.

Glue the yellow strip to the bottom and the orange strip just above it. Cut the excess paper around the edges. Give the glue a few minutes to dry.

To make the face first cut 2 small circles from the glitter card stock for the eyes. Glue the circles onto the candy corn and press to secure.

Finish the eyes by using a black marker to make the pupils. To personalize your candy corn, give it a smile!

Lastly, glue a wooden craft stick to the back to give it a handle for play or display!

Pro Tip!

If construction paper is unavailable, you could also paint or color this craft with crayons.
